The particular story of the particular man who saw "trees walking"
One of the most interesting biblical parallels to blurry vision is found in the Gospel of Mark. There's a story exactly where Jesus heals a blind man, but it doesn't happen at one time. After the first touch, Jesus demands the man if he or she sees anything. The man replies, "I see people; these people look like trees and shrubs walking around. "
Believe about that with regard to a second. He or she wasn't blind anymore, but his vision was still blurry and distorted. He could see shapes plus movement, but this individual couldn't distinguish the important points. Jesus had to touch his eyes a second time just before his sight has been fully restored.
If you're experiencing blurry vision in your desires, you may be in that will "middle stage" of healing or revelation. You've moved away of total darkness, but you haven't quite reached full clarity. This is definitely a very human being place to end up being. It's a stage of transition. It suggests that Lord does a work in your existence, but the process isn't finished. You're seeing "men such as trees, " and also you might need to stay in plea or stay affected individual until that 2nd "touch" of clearness comes.
Viewing through a cup darkly
The apostle Paul had written something famous in 1 Corinthians thirteen: 12: "For right now we see through a glass, darkly; but then face to face. " In the ancient globe, mirrors weren't an ideal silvered glass we have today; they were polished metal that gave a dim, somewhat distorted representation.
This particular verse is a huge clue with regards to the blurry vision in dream biblical meaning. It will remind us that whilst we're on this side of perpetuity, we're never heading to have 100% perfect clarity everywhere. We see points "darkly" or "dimly. " If your own dream features this kind of fuzziness, it could simply be a humble reminder that you're human and you don't have got all the solutions. It's an support to lean more on faith and less on your own own physical senses or logic.

The role of religious "eye salve"
In the Book of Revelation, there's a letter in order to the church in Laodicea where these people are told these are "blind" despite considering they see great. The counsel provided to them is to buy "eye salve" to anoint their eyes so they may see.
When all of us discuss the blurry vision in dream biblical meaning, we all have to consider if there's some thing "clouding" our spiritual sight. In the Bible, things such as pride, unforgiveness, or even being double-minded action like a movie over our eyes. If your life seems like it's in a fog, your desires will often reflect that. The "eye salve" in this particular context is repentance plus a refocusing upon what truly matters. It's about cleaning away the distractions of the planet so that you can see the particular kingdom of Lord clearly again.
